Output 8a4b04c8e7a4b25137c236191bba5dbcbddb8d59cd2f216512ba24cd90298585:0

value
506760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e68b1c4729db5e9ecb59e3128376b63c4e82fb6 OP_EQUAL
address
3Eg1J5VutQTvFofXuHGTxJ1kyXFtogkN7B
transaction
8a4b04c8e7a4b25137c236191bba5dbcbddb8d59cd2f216512ba24cd90298585
confirmations
268614
spent
true